BREAKING NEWS: Sunday Best Finalist Dontavies Boatwright Passes Away at 33


Dontavies-Boatwright_GloryToGlory-itunesSunday Best Season two finalist Dontavies Boatwright passed away today.

Boatwright, 33, died of a heart attack this morning. He collapsed after complaining of chest pains, and paramedics were unable to revive him.

The news comes as a shock to fans and the Gospel community, as a young Dontavies was preparing for the release of his new album scheduled to hit stores in the fall of 2013. Continue reading

President Obama Re-Elected for Second Term – America’s Decision Leaves Both Candidates Expressing the Role of Faith in the Coming Months


ObamaPresident Obama was re-elected for a second term last night, and an exuberant base of supporters dreamed of progress in the coming four years.

Obama’s acceptance speech, and Romney’s concession speech had under-tones of faith and hope as they expressed a willingness to work with each other in Obama’s second term.

As Mitt Romney delayed conceding the victory too long for some, he took the stage in defeat graciously.  “This is a time of great challenges for America, and I pray that the president will be successful in guiding our nation.” Continue reading



TONEX Says People are Born Homosexual & Call Him B-Slade


B-SladeThe Path MEGAzine catches up with the artist formerly known as TONEX. He is now going by the name B-Slade. B-Slade graciously grants us an interview after stepping off the stage of the Bonnerfied Radio’s anniversary celebration at the 26th annual Stellar Awards.

The performance would be the largest public performance that B-Slade has done since announcing that he was gay on the now cancelled Lexi Show. You could tell that the interview, and the controversy was still fresh on B-Slade’s mind, as he changed the lyrics of his hit song “The Trust Theory” to include not speaking with Kirk Franklin in about 6 years and dropping Lexi’s name later in the next sentence.  Continue reading



Isaac Carree Talks about Singing Background for Years before Billboard #1 Debut


Isaac CarreeIsaac Carree is a singer, songwriter, producer, and actor.  For over a decade Isaac has sung background for the likes of Kirk Franklin and John P. Kee.  Now Isaac is stepping out with his first CD “Uncommon Me” which stunned everyone except Carree by going #1 on the Billboard Gospel charts.

Following the success of his debut single, “Simply Redeemed,” the sweet sounding Isaac Carree released the foot stomping single “In The Middle.”  Continue reading
